This dish is essentially just a whole lot of chopped up veggies and shrimp. It's got yellow bell peppers, green peppers, tomatoes, onions, and jalepenos all chopped up in there, along with a whole heap of shrimp and avocado thrown on top for good measure (check out the link below for the exact recipe). WOD 100824 Tuesday

Warm-up
S/S: Deadlift, 5-5-5-5-5
WOD: With a 3 minute running clock, do a handstand hold against a wall. When you come out of the handstand, perform as many burpees as possible before you hit the 3 minute mark. Rest for 2 minutes. Complete this cycle for a total of five rounds.
*Your score is the total amount of seconds that you spend in a handstand; for every burpee you complete, add one second to your total score (this workout comes courtesy of CrossFit One World).
Finish: 30m Suicides. Place markers 5m apart for 30m; sprint to each, touching the ground at each marker. Complete 3 total suicides.
